Knitting, wrong size needles, should I add stitches?

Knitting, wrong size needles, should I add stitches?

Answer:

This piece of knitting is going to be felted so does need to be done on big needles or it will not felt successfully1 size different would not matter much but 4 sizes bigger means I think you will be disappointed with the resultsThe felting shrinks the knitting so it needs to be knitted on a much looser gauge than usualAs you knit you will probably think it looks too loose, as it would be if you weren't felting the finished pieceThe felting process fills up the holes to make the close fabric that is feltIf you use a small needle to knit with the felt comes out stiff as a board.
